Biography: Dr. Thomas Clark is a Family Medicine Physician who's well-versed and passionate about managing chronic diseases such as diabetes, heart disease, metabolic syndromes, and obesity.Born and raised in Logan, Utah, Dr. Clark went to Utah State University for his undergraduate education and University of Utah for his medical doctorate. His internship and residency were completed at Naval Hospital Camp Pendleton in Oceanside, California.Outside of the office, he's an avid soccer player who plays recreationally and coached on-and-off for over 20 years. Dr. Clark has been married for 30+ years with three children and a growing family of grandkids. He enjoys helping his wife maintain her garden of 200+ varieties of iris, continually moving, and constantly learning.

Biography: Jeremy Starr DO was raised in the Tremonton and Providence areas.At the age of 12, his family moved to Montana where he finished high school and still considers this home. Dr. Starr attended Ricks College and Idaho State University where he received associate degrees in Arts and Science. Dr. Starr completed medical school at the University of Health Sciences in Kansas City, Missouri and completed a 1 year traditional Osteopathic internship in Independence, Mo.He then completed his residency in Casper, Wyoming. After residency, he practiced rural family medicine, including emergency medicine and obstetrics, in Kemmerer, Wyoming for 12 years. Dr. Starr loves the variety of family medicine and being able to provide complete care for the entire family, from newborns to older adults. Dr. Starr offers Osteopathic manipulation in his practice along with many other office- based procedures. Dr. Starr and his wife Carrie have been married for 27 years and have four sons and one daughter in law.He enjoysskiing with his wife at Beaver Mountain, camping and hiking with his family, and watching and listening to his wife sing in the American Festival chorus.He is a BYU fan and loves going to BYU football games, Don't hold it against him.

Biography: Dr. Glenn Robertson is a experienced Family Medicine physician at Ogden Clinic Cache Valley with over 25 years of practice in both Family Medicine and Emergency Medicine. He earned his Bachelor of Science in Pre-Med and Zoology from Brigham Young University and went on to receive his Doctor of Medicine from Eastern Virginia Medical School. He completed his Family Medicine residency at Duke Southern Regional AHEC.Dr. Robertson's professional journey brought him to Cache Valley after he and his family visited Utah several times while his children attended Utah State University. Drawn to the area's beauty and lifestyle, he decided to relocate and continue his practice in the community.As a survivor of Non-Hodgkin's Lymphoma, Dr. Robertson brings a deeply personal understanding to his work, providing compassionate care to his patients. His clinical interests include primary care for patients of all ages, as well as specialized procedures such as colonoscopies and upper endoscopies.When he's not working, Dr. Robertson enjoys outdoor activities, particularly hiking and skiing, and cherishes spending quality time with his family.
